WebNov 15, 2024 · Here's how to do it: Open the Run dialog box, type msinfo32, and press Enter. It'll open the System information window. Click System Summary in the left panel. Check the Secure Boot State in the right pane. If the Secure Boot status is Off, you'll have to enable it through your BIOS.
